WebOct 16, 2024 · Browsing history is a record of web pages you have visited. Edge will store details of pages you visit for up to three months; this is what you see on the History page. If you delete your browsing history, you can't get those records back unless you have a backup of your Edge user data. WebOct 11, 2024 · 2 As an adult in the family, go to the Microsoft Family website, sign in with your Microsoft account if not already, and go to … WebOn your computer, open Chrome. At the top right, click More . Click More tools Clear browsing data. Choose a time range, like Last hour or All time. Select the types of information you want to remove. Click Clear data. Note: If you delete cookies and have sync turned on, Chrome keeps you signed into your Google Account. cindy coughlin
